About CAPRI SENIOR COMMUNITIES
"It's not just my apartment, it's my home!" For over two decades, Capri Senior Communities has provided quality, caring management for seniors. Based in Waukesha, Wisconsin, we at Capri pride ourselves on being able to offer hands-on management and care for every community that our seniors call "home." Every one of our communities is designed to help our residents live as independently as possible

What Is the Cost of Living Near Waukesha?

Understanding the cost of living near Waukesha is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Capri Senior Communities.
Waukesha's Cost of Living Index is approximately 95.3 (4.7% less expensive than US average; 0.5% more than WI average). Milwaukee suburb, housing near US avg. Waukesha Metro. When planning your budget based on a salary from Capri Senior Communities, consider these typical monthly expenses:
